// Theme client for the Ironvale admin dashboard. Dark-mode tokens are
// fetched from the internal Palette service at boot, not bundled — keeps
// the two themes in sync with design without redeploys. Falls back to
// baked-in light theme if Palette is unreachable; don't remove that path.
// Cache TTL is 10 minutes. Reviewer: check the contrast map merge logic
// in applyTheme(). The client authenticates with the key on the next line.

API key for tagef-fafop: vxb2-ta

The Textgate upload service on the Harlow cluster has drifted from the values checked into the provisioning repo. Specifically, the byte-sniffing sample size and the fallback charset differ between nodes hl-03 and hl-07, which explains why identical uploaded text files are detected as UTF-8 on one node and Latin-1 on the other. We traced this to a manual hotfix applied during the March incident that was never backported. Before reconciling, record the current live state. The values observed on hl-03 at the time of filing are as follows.

service settings:
novath:
  pin: 1396
  tenant: pelys
  seal: seal_ccc035e1
  metrics_host: metrics.novath.qorvelworks.test
  standby_team: fraeth
  escalation: drueth-zorok
  nonce: 61d508

## Tuning the Seat-Map Renderer

The Gildenrow Theatre seat map renders up to 2,800 seats as instanced quads. Performance hinges on two tradeoffs: tile size for the hit-test grid (smaller tiles speed hover lookups but inflate memory), and the debounce window on zoom events (shorter feels snappier but triggers redundant relayouts on trackpads). We tuned these against the balcony view, our worst case, on a mid-range tablet. Please review any change to these values alongside the benchmark results, starting from the current baseline:

tuning table, faduf-baduf:
PRIORITIES = {
    "ulavan": 191,
    "silys": 750,
    "goriel": 238,
    "kelmir": 66,
    "wendor": 432,
}